PUGET SOUND POWER LIGHT COMPANY "Company and CITY OF
TUKWI LA "Customer agree as follows:
FIRST: This contract is for mercury vapor street lighting service.
SECOND: TERM. The term of this contract is for an initial period of FIVE (5)
consecutive years beginning May 28 1974 and thereafterforsuccessiveperiods
of the same number of years, until terminated at the end of any such period, initial or
successive, by either party delivering notice of termination to the other party at least
thirty (30) days prior to the expiration of such period. If addressed to a party's address
last known to the sending party and mailed in the United States mail, notice shall be
deemed delivered to that party on the third day following the date of posting.
THIRD: SERVICES TO BE RENDERED. In consideration of the mutual promises, and
subject to the limitations herein contained, the Company agrees to furnish the necessary
electric energy requi red for dusk to dawn mercury vapor I ighti ng of streets, alleys and other
public thoroughfares which can be served fromtheCompany's existing distribution system
and to perform repairs and routine maintenance work as specified in the Company's en-
gineering standards. Repairs and maintenance work will be performed during the regularly
scheduled working hours of the Company. Individual lamps will be replaced on burnout, as
soon as reasonably possible after notification by the Customer and subject tot the Com-
pany's operating schedules and requirements. Customer agrees to purchase from the
Company, exclusively, all electric service required or used to operate customer street
lighting facilities at the rates herein fixed. Said facilities are located and described as
follows:
4 400.watt mercury vapor street lights, company owned;
141 175 watt mercury vapor street lights, company owned;
25 700 watt mercury vapor street lights, customer owned; and
200 400 watt mercury vapor street lights, customer owned, located within
the Cit of Tukwila Kin County, Washington
FOURTH: RATES. Customer agrees to pay for the electric service and energy furnished

FIFTH: INSTALLATIONS OF CUSTOMER -OWNED SYSTEM. A system installed and
wholly owned by the Customer shall conform to the Company's specifications for such
type of system in effect atthetimeof installation and shall be installed without expense
to the Company
SIXTH: LINE EXTENSIONS. Underground distribution circuits will be extended by the
Company for any service under this schedule only at the Customer's expense.
SEVENTH: THIRD PARTY DAMAGE.
A. Company -Owned Installations Street lighting facilities which
experience malicious and /or recurring damage caused by actions
of third parties shall be subject to removal by the Company
and /or payment by the Customer for such damage.
B. Customer -Owned Installations The Customer shall pay for re-
pair and /or maintenance work required (including replacement
of damaged parts, if necessary) caused by actions of third
parties, whether by accident or otherwise.
EIGHTH: CHANGE OF LOCATION. The location of Company -owned street lighting may
be changed at Customer request and upon payment by the Customer of the costs of re-
moval and reinstallation.
NINTH: SUBJECT TO REGULATORY AUTHORITY. The rights and obligations of the
parties hereunder are subject to the authority of any regulatory agency having jurisdiction
and to the Company's applicable schedules and tariffs, as they may be amended from time
to time, on file with any such regulatory agency, including, without limitation, the Com-
pany's General Rules and Provisions and its Tax Adjustment Schedule on file with the
Washington Utilities and Transportation Commission, all of which schedules and tariffs are
by this reference incorporated herein and made a part hereof. The rates hereunder are
subject to change by authority of any such regulatory agency or upon the effectiveness of
a superseding schedule of rates governing the electric service rendered hereunder filed with
such regulatory agency. Upon the effective date of such change, the Customer shall there-
after pay for service at the new rate.
